摘要: 目标: Collection集合的遍历方式。 什么是遍历? 为什么开发中要遍历? 遍历就是一个一个的把容器中的元素访问一遍。 开发中经常要统计元素的总和,找最值,找出某个数据然后干掉等等业务都需要遍历。 Collection集合的遍历方式是全部集合都可以直接使用的,所以我们学习它。 Collecti 阅读全文
posted @ 2021-01-25 21:43 AxeBurner 阅读(144) 评论(0) 推荐(0) 编辑
摘要: 阅读全文
posted @ 2021-01-25 20:40 AxeBurner 阅读(27) 评论(0) 推荐(0) 编辑
摘要: 目标: 记住集合的常用API: (其实就是记住Collection的方法 因为Collection是集合的祖宗类 只要是集合 它的方法都可以调用) 这里直接用案例来使用说明: package com.ithei.Collection; import java.util.ArrayList; impo 阅读全文
posted @ 2021-01-25 16:58 AxeBurner 阅读(203) 评论(0) 推荐(0) 编辑
摘要: 目标: Collection集合概述。 什么是集合? 集合是一个大小可变的容器。 容器中的每个数据称为一个元素。数据==元素。 集合的特点是:类型可以不确定,大小不固定。集合有很多种,不同的集合特点和使用场景不同。 数组:类型和长度一旦定义出来就都固定了。 集合有啥用? 在开发中,很多时候元素的个数 阅读全文
posted @ 2021-01-25 16:23 AxeBurner 阅读(629) 评论(0) 推荐(0) 编辑
摘要: 需求: 开发一个极品飞车的游戏,所有的汽车都能一起参与比赛。 注意: 虽然BMW和BENZ都继承了Car 但是ArrayList<BMW>和ArrayLIst<BENZ>与ArrayList<Car>没有关系的!泛型没有继承关系! 通配符:? ? 可以用在使用泛型的时候代表一切类型。 E,T,K,V 阅读全文
posted @ 2021-01-25 15:04 AxeBurner 阅读(97) 评论(0) 推荐(0) 编辑
摘要: 什么是泛型接口? 使用了泛型定义的接口就是泛型接口。 泛型接口的格式: 修饰符 interface 接口名称<泛型变量>{ } 需求: 教务系统,提供一个接口可约束一定要完成数据(学生,老师)的增删改查操作 小结: 泛型接口的核心思想,在实现接口的时候传入真实的数据类型 这样重写的方法就是对该数据类 阅读全文
posted @ 2021-01-25 14:23 AxeBurner 阅读(197) 评论(0) 推荐(0) 编辑